[ccpw id="5"]

HomeCách mạng hóa Độ truy cập: Cách Slack tích hợp Kiểm tra...

Cách mạng hóa Độ truy cập: Cách Slack tích hợp Kiểm tra Tự động hóa

-

Giới thiệu

Trong một thế giới ngày càng kỹ thuật số, việc đảm bảo rằng tất cả người dùng, bất kể khả năng của họ, có thể truy cập và điều hướng các nền tảng trực tuyến là vô cùng quan trọng. Tại Slack, việc tích hợp một chiến lược truy cập vững chắc không chỉ là tiêu chuẩn tuân thủ mà còn là một khía cạnh cơ bản của quá trình phát triển sản phẩm. Chuyến hành trình của công ty vào kiểm tra độ truy cập tự động đánh dấu một cột mốc quan trọng trong việc nâng cao trải nghiệm người dùng và sự tin tưởng của khách hàng.

Cam kết về Độ truy cập

Cam kết của Slack trong việc tạo ra một môi trường inclusive được tóm gọn trong các tiêu chuẩn truy cập của họ, phù hợp với Hướng dẫn về Độ truy cập Nội dung Web (WCAG). Với sự hỗ trợ của một đội ngũ chuyên trách về độ truy cập và các kiểm thử viên bên ngoài, Slack hướng tới việc xây dựng các tính năng phản ánh tuân thủ thực sự và đáp ứng nhu cầu của người dùng khuyết tật. Cam kết này là nền tảng cho các phương pháp sáng tạo của họ, kết hợp công cụ tự động với những hiểu biết từ con người trong toàn bộ quy trình thiết kế và kiểm tra.

Sự ra đời của Kiểm tra Độ truy cập Tự động

Vào năm 2022, Slack đã bắt đầu một sứ mệnh để mở rộng khung kiểm tra hiện có thông qua các kiểm tra độ truy cập tự động. Bằng cách tích hợp công cụ kiểm tra độ truy cập Axe vào khung phát triển desktop của họ, Slack nhằm mục đích tối ưu hóa quy trình kiểm tra và nâng cao hiệu suất của nhà phát triển. Tuy nhiên, hành trình tích hợp đã giới thiệu những phức tạp không ngờ, đặc biệt là trong việc hòa hợp công cụ này với các khung hiện có.

Vượt qua các Thách thức trong Tích hợp

Việc chọn làm việc với Axe vì tính linh hoạt và khả năng tuân thủ rộng rãi là một quyết định chiến lược. Tuy nhiên, sự tương tác giữa Axe, Jest và Thư viện Kiểm tra React đã đặt ra những thách thức đáng kể. Việc cấu hình lại thiết lập hiện có là cồng kềnh và không thực tế, prompting một sự chuyển hướng sang khung Playwright, cho phép linh hoạt hơn và tích hợp liền mạch cho các kiểm tra độ truy cập.

Tùy chỉnh Khung Kiểm tra

Thông qua việc tùy chỉnh và các giải pháp sáng tạo, Slack đã thành công trong việc nhúng các kiểm tra Axe vào khung Playwright. Nỗ lực này bao gồm việc tạo ra một quy trình làm việc mạch lạc cho phép các nhà phát triển thực hiện các kiểm tra độ truy cập song song với các quy trình kiểm tra thông thường của họ mà không làm tăng đáng kể khối lượng công việc hoặc độ phức tạp. Với các loại trừ được định nghĩa sẵn cho các vấn đề đã biết và các tùy chọn tùy chỉnh cho các mức độ vi phạm khác nhau, Slack đảm bảo rằng các kiểm tra độ truy cập vừa thực tiễn vừa hiệu quả.

Báo cáo Vi phạm một cách Hiệu quả

Báo cáo kết quả của các kiểm tra độ truy cập trở thành một quy trình lặp lại, dẫn đến các cải tiến bao gồm các hỗ trợ hình ảnh như ảnh chụp màn hình và báo cáo cấu trúc thông qua Trình báo cáo HTML của Playwright. Những cải tiến này không chỉ nâng cao độ rõ ràng mà còn thúc đẩy một cách tiếp cận dễ tiếp cận để hiểu các kết quả của các bài kiểm tra.

Khuyến khích Các Thực hành Tốt của Nhà phát triển

Để thúc đẩy sự sở hữu trong số các nhà phát triển, Slack đã thiết lập các hướng dẫn rõ ràng cho việc thực hiện các kiểm tra độ truy cập trong quá trình phát triển, bao gồm các lệnh chạy theo yêu cầu và theo kế hoạch. Một cờ môi trường cung cấp sự linh hoạt cần thiết để kiểm soát thời điểm các bài kiểm tra này được kích hoạt, đảm bảo rằng các nhà phát triển có thể tích hợp tuân thủ một cách hiệu quả mà không làm gián đoạn quy trình làm việc.

Triển vọng Tương lai về Kiểm tra Độ truy cập

Nhìn về phía trước, sự hợp tác của Slack với đội ngũ nội bộ về độ truy cập nhằm mục đích tiếp tục tinh chế quy trình kiểm tra tự động và khám phá các công nghệ AI để tối ưu hóa các cuộc kiểm toán độ truy cập. Việc tích hợp AI hứa hẹn không chỉ nâng cao hiệu quả kiểm tra mà còn giải phóng các nhà phát triển khỏi một số gánh nặng thủ công liên quan đến việc tuân thủ độ truy cập.

Những điểm chính

  • Slack đặt độ truy cập là giá trị cốt lõi của công ty, thực hiện các tiêu chuẩn phù hợp với WCAG.
  • Sự tích hợp của các công cụ kiểm tra độ truy cập tự động như Axe trong các khung hiện có nâng cao quy trình kiểm tra.
  • Cấu trúc báo cáo rõ ràng và tùy chỉnh trong kiểm tra có thể đơn giản hóa các kiểm tra độ truy cập cho các nhà phát triển.
  • Sự hợp tác với các đội ngũ nội bộ và việc khám phá các công nghệ AI sẽ thúc đẩy các nỗ lực độ truy cập trong tương lai.

LEAVE A REPLY

Please enter your comment!
Please enter your name here

LATEST POSTS

Tăng Trưởng Toàn Cầu Của AI Trong Ngân Hàng: Một Thị Trường Đang Tăng Trưởng

Giới Thiệu Cảnh quan ngân hàng toàn cầu đang phát triển nhanh chóng khi trí tuệ nhân tạo (AI) tạo dấu ấn của mình. Với một...

Tôi Kiểm Tra Bộ Bữa Ăn Cho Cuộc Sống. Đây Là Những Dụng Cụ Nhà Bếp Thiết Yếu Của Tôi

Giới thiệu Khi thế giới ẩm thực tiếp tục phát triển, bộ bữa ăn đã xuất hiện như một giải pháp tiện lợi cho các hộ...

Khi Crypto Restaking Bùng Nổ, Sự Đa Dạng Là Cần Thiết Để Cân Bằng Rủi Ro và Phần Thưởng

Giới thiệu Sự gia tăng nhanh chóng của các token restaking thanh khoản (LRTs) đã đánh dấu một kỷ nguyên mới trong tài chính phi tập...

Mở Khóa Tiềm Năng Của Blockchain: Vượt Qua Tiền Điện Tử

Giới Thiệu Sự gia tăng của tiền điện tử đã thu hút các nhà đầu tư và nhà hoạch định chính sách, nhưng ở cốt lõi...

Most Popular

spot_img